5/22 Website design

Today we worked on website design. The assignment is to create a website with at least 5 pages outside of the home page and a link on every page that leads back to the home page. We searched "webpage" in web2.0 and tried several webpage design sites that help you build your own site. I used Kafafa.com. I love this site! Its free for simple page design, which is all I'd use it for and it was very easy to use. One of my ideas for my future class was to creat a class website so this assignment is right up my alley. I was able to throw together a skeleton of a site in only 30 minutes with links to helpful resources, and pictures.
Next we were introduced to the dreamweaver program. This is another program that helps you design a website. I can't say that I enjoyed dreamweaver. It is very technical and you need a background in computer code to understand how to use it and be successful in the design of your page. I can't see myself seeking it out in the future for my class webpage. I'd be much more likely to use a simple and free program to create something for my kids and their parents.
